AI Summary

  • Adds a new "Special Appraiser" category to Oklahoma's certified real estate appraiser classifications, requiring no examination and a minimum of 75 classroom hours in real estate or appraisal courses from approved organizations or institutions.

  • Special Appraisers must be supervised by qualified Board members or another qualified licensed appraiser, with the Board defining educational and experience standards for this category.

  • Directs the Insurance Commissioner to assist the Board in expediting regulations and standards for the new Special Appraiser category.

  • Amends the Board's powers to include defining regulations and standards for Special Appraisers where such individuals are supervised by the Board or designated qualified persons.

  • Effective date: November 1, 2017.

Legislative Description

Real estate appraisers; category of appraisers; directing certain supervision. Effective date.
